Capabilities Mapped
A robot equipped with mapping capabilities can keep track of your floor plan, and also navigate better than a robot without this technology. This helps a robotic mopping system to avoid hitting carpeted areas and ensures they are not accidentally wet.
Smart robots come with a variety of sensors and technologies that enable them to analyze their surroundings, including lasers and 3D obstacle detection. They also employ LIDAR. The result is more thorough and reliable cleaning than what you'd get from a non-mapping robotic.
Some robots detect carpets and increase suction to prevent obstruction. This is a handy feature when you have areas of your home with carpet and hard flooring elsewhere. Other robots allow you to create "no-go" zones through their apps that block off certain rooms or floors.
The applications for these robots will allow you to instruct your bot to clean a single space or area this is beneficial when you need to scour the living area in a hurry after your children spill something. If your robot is equipped with a dual-function that vacuums and mops, the apps will allow you to switch between these modes.
The dust bin can be easily removed and empty from models that mop and vacuum. The filter can be rinsed and dried prior to reinstalling. The majority of manufacturers suggest that you replace the filter once every year or so, although it is contingent on how often you use your robot. Also, it is recommended to regularly replace and check mopping pads if purchase disposable ones. If you buy reusable pads, make sure you wash them between uses.

4. Easy to Maintain
A robotic floor cleaner can be an essential tool for keeping your home spotless regularly. A robot mop is a great method to keep floors looking good between deep cleaning sessions. It can also help you avoid "sticky" and "greasy" floors that result from frequent manual mopping.
The best self cleaning vacuum mopping robots feature an array of sensors and technology to detect their surroundings, which include furniture, walls, and other obstacles. They make use of a combination of roller brushes, side brushes and mops to thoroughly clean floors and get rid of dust from cracks. After that, they return to their dock to recharge and reset.
Some of the simplest models have a single water reservoir and a static pad that spritzes and wipes. Advanced models come with more special pads that move or rotate to scrub off dirt. Self-emptying docks make it simple to clean or replace brushes and dump dirty water. Some models have onboard sensors that claim to be able to detect the flooring's texture which means they can avoid carpets and only clean hard floors.
